Longitudinally Serrated Mikulicz Peritoneum Forceps is a specialized device that abdominal and general surgeons use to grasp, mobilize and statically hold soft tissues and peritoneum, in order to gain improved access into the surgical field.
- Longitudinal Serrations Promoting Atraumatic Clamping.
- Ratchet System for Self-Locking the Jaws.
- Ergonomic Finger Rings Ensuring Optimal Handling.
The Longitudinally Serrated Mikulicz Peritoneum Forceps offers a wide array of surgical benefits. Its principal use is to provide an atraumatic way to clamp and retract peritoneum flaps.
For this purpose, the instrument features a pair of curved jaws that conform to the abdominal cavity’s anatomy. In addition, the jaws have longitudinal serrations along their inner surface to obtain an enhanced gripping.
Moreover, the Longitudinally Serrated Mikulicz Peritoneum Forceps features interlocking teeth to grasp heavy tissues. Also, the device has elongated shafts to allow access into a variety of surgical sites.
